Surf Theatre
4520 Irving Street,
San Francisco,
CA
94122
4520 Irving Street,
San Francisco,
CA
94122
2 people favorited this theater
Uploaded By
More Photos of This Theater
October 6, 1976. Renoir’s 1931 film.
No one has favorited this photo yet